You might try Davy Byrne's just a few blocks away.

http://www.davybyrnes.com

Had lunch there twice and thought it was good. Would have visited anyway because of the Joycean connection -- Leopold Bloom has a gorgonzola sandwich and a glass of Burgundy there in <i>Ulysses</i>.
